Company Description
Founded by experienced entrepreneurs and engineers in 2016, Pismo is a technology company that provides a comprehensive processing platform for banking, card issuing and financial market infrastructure and helps customers innovate and build the next generation of banking and payment solutions. Pismo joined Visa in 2024.
Leveraging Visa’s solutions, our core platform, and an expanding suite of capabilities, Pismo addresses the technological challenges that large banks, marketplaces, and fintech companies face in migrating from legacy systems to more advanced technology in the market. Pismo’s cloud-based platform empowers firms to build and launch financial products rapidly, scaling as they grow to have a broader audience while keeping high security and availability standards.
Pismo’s 500+ employees are located in more than 10 countries around the world.
Job Description
We are the Depositary team, the core engineering group responsible for supporting and managing card receivables through the BCB's centralized registration system. Monitor and reconcile receivables units (URs) across multiple acquirers and payment arrangements. Ensure compliance with BCB regulations, including Circular 3,952 and related normative frameworks. Support credit operations backed by card receivables as collateral. Maintain data integrity across receivables registration, pledges, and settlements. Facilitate liquidity solutions for merchants through receivables anticipation and discounting operations.
